List View WebPart custom XSL link disabled Ribbon Buttons

$
0
0

Hi,

I have added and external XSLT file for my List View web part. I followed these options in browser -> Edit page -> Edit web part -> Under Miscellaneous updated XSL Link.

I am using this xslt file to add background colors to one of my column. The xslt is getting applied correctly. But I noticed that "View Item" and "Edit Item" option in ribbon is disabled. I removed the xslt link and ribbon worked fine.

I have added the xslt file to site collection's "Style Library -> XSL Style Sheets" folder.

When I added same xslt by editing the page in SPD 2010, everything worked fine. The problem appears only when I apply it externally. I found in few posts where they suggest to upload the xsl file in LAYOUTS folder. But I donot have access/permission to change the LayOuts folder. I donot want to edit in SPD because, it will be difficult for non technical administrators to apply xslt to other views/pages. Please suggest.
